When spoken three times and followed by a location, this is the intercom code for fire at Toys 'R Us. Intended to prevent a panic, employees are supposed to use this code to call a manager to the fire location to deal with it. How a fire would start in Toys 'R Us, I have no idea, or how people could not notice the plastic-toy-induced-acrid-smoke. I'm not sure if similar codes are used at other large stores such as Wal-Mart or Sears but I'd imagine they do have some way of bringing help to the location without shouting over the intercom, "FIRE IN AISLE 5!"
